Inhibitor Therapeutics, Inc. (INTI) is a biotechnology firm focused on developing innovative therapies for cancer and autoimmune diseases. The company's unique competitive advantage lies in its proprietary drug discovery platform, which leverages advanced computational biology to identify novel drug candidates more efficiently than traditional methods.
INTI generates revenue primarily through partnerships with larger pharmaceutical firms, providing them with access to its drug discovery technologies and potential drug candidates. The company holds a strong position in the oncology space, particularly with its lead candidate targeting a specific cancer biomarker, which enhances its pricing power and marketability.
